What the Laboratory Actually Needs From You

Ask a technician why a case came back wrong and the answer is rarely about the ceramic. It is about information: a shade taken after the teeth had been isolated for twenty minutes, a prescription that said improve the smile, photographs shot under operatory lighting with no reference, or preparations that left no space to work with.

The technician is not in the room. They never see the patient, never hear what the patient asked for, and never watch how the lip moves when the patient talks. Everything they know arrives in a box or a file, and the quality of what comes back is limited by the quality of what went out.

This is one of the more improvable areas in esthetic dentistry, because most of it costs nothing but attention.

Photography Is the Primary Language

Written descriptions of appearance do not transfer. Photographs do, and a standardised series communicates more in five images than several paragraphs of prescription.

What a technician can actually use: full face at rest and smiling, so proportion and midline are visible in context. Retracted views showing the teeth in relation to each other. Close-up detail of the adjacent and opposing teeth that the restorations must live alongside. Lateral views showing how the smile reads from an angle. And images that capture the character of the natural dentition, meaning surface texture, incisal translucency, and any staining or characterisation the patient wants matched.

Consistency is what makes a series useful. The same views, framed the same way, under the same lighting, every time. A technician who receives consistent photography from a practice learns to read that practice’s images accurately, which is a compounding benefit over cases.

Cross-polarised imaging is worth understanding for shade work specifically, since removing surface reflection reveals underlying colour and characterisation in a way conventional photography does not.

Shade Communication Fails More Than Anything Else

This is the single most common source of a case coming back wrong, and the mechanism is usually timing rather than judgement.

Teeth dehydrate when isolated, and dehydrated teeth lighten. A shade taken partway through an appointment, after retraction and isolation, records a tooth that will not look like that once rehydrated. The restoration is then made to match something that does not exist.

The practical answer is to take shade at the start of the appointment, before isolation, under consistent lighting, with the patient’s face at eye level and the tab held adjacent to the tooth rather than against it.

Photographing the shade tab in frame alongside the tooth converts a subjective judgement into something the technician can verify. Multiple tabs bracketing the estimate are more useful than a single one, because they show the technician where the target sits between references.

The point most often omitted entirely is the preparation shade. Thin ceramic is not fully opaque, so the underlying tooth colour influences the final result. A discoloured or endodontically treated substrate under a thin restoration will show through unless the technician knows about it and can plan for it. Photographing and recording the prepared tooth shade is a small step that prevents an entire category of failure.

The Prescription Is a Design Brief

Most prescriptions record shade, material, and a delivery date. The useful ones record intent.

What genuinely helps a technician: what the patient asked for in their own words, what was agreed as achievable, which features should be preserved and which changed, how much characterisation is wanted, and whether the patient is seeking a natural result that blends or a more uniform one.

Also valuable is what to avoid, since patients frequently express preferences as negatives. Someone who says they do not want to look fake has given the technician a genuine constraint.

Where a case has a specific functional consideration, that belongs in the prescription too. A technician who knows about a parafunctional history designs differently from one who does not.

The test of a prescription is whether a technician who has never spoken to you could produce what you have in mind from it. Most cannot, which is why the phone call on a complex case remains worth the five minutes.

Preparations Communicate As Well

The preparation itself is information, and it constrains what the technician can do regardless of everything sent alongside it.

Insufficient space is the recurring problem. Ceramic needs adequate thickness to develop colour and translucency, and a technician given inadequate space has two options, both bad: build over-contoured restorations, or make thin ones that appear flat and let the substrate show. Neither is a laboratory failure, though it is frequently reported as one.

Margin clarity matters equally. Margins that cannot be read on a model or in a scan get interpreted, and interpretation is guesswork. Whether the workflow is conventional or digital, the technician needs to see where the preparation ends.

Sending the provisional design, a matrix, or a wax-up reference alongside the case tells the technician what was agreed with the patient rather than leaving them to infer it.

Provisionals as the Blueprint

Provisionals are frequently treated as a holding measure. Used properly they are the most useful communication tool in the entire workflow.

A well-made provisional tests the proposed result in the patient’s mouth: how it looks when they speak and smile, how it functions, whether the incisal position works with the lip, and whether the patient actually likes it. That is information no photograph or wax-up can fully provide, because it exists in the patient’s face rather than on a model.

Once the patient has approved a provisional, it becomes a specification. Photographs of the approved provisional and a matrix taken from it tell the technician exactly what the target is, which converts a subjective brief into something reproducible.

Where a patient asks for changes during the provisional phase, those changes are considerably cheaper to make in resin than in ceramic. That is the entire argument for taking the provisional stage seriously, and it is the stage most often rushed.

Try-In and the Last Conversation

The try-in appointment is the final opportunity to change anything, and it works best when treated as an evaluation rather than a formality.

Worth assessing before anything is cemented: fit and margins, shade under more than one light source, how the restorations read at conversational distance rather than only at arm’s length, function, and the patient’s own reaction seen in a mirror in normal lighting.

Try-in pastes matter for translucent restorations, since the cement shade influences the final appearance, and evaluating without them assesses something other than the finished result.

Where something is not right, saying so at try-in is straightforward and saying so afterward is not. Cementation is the point at which the options narrow considerably.

Remakes and What They Reveal

Remakes happen, and how a practice handles them determines whether they generate improvement or resentment.

The productive approach is diagnostic rather than adversarial. What specifically is wrong, what information would have prevented it, and what should change next time. A technician who receives that question honestly will usually answer it honestly, including when the answer implicates what was sent.

Tracking remakes over time surfaces patterns. A practice with recurring shade issues has a shade protocol problem. One with recurring fit issues has an impression or scan problem. One with recurring esthetic disagreements has a communication problem at the prescription or provisional stage. Each has a different fix, and none is solved by changing laboratories.

Choosing a Technician

The relationship matters more than the price list.

What to look for: willingness to discuss cases rather than only receive them, honesty about what the sent information does and does not support, consistency across cases, and a genuine interest in the esthetic result rather than only the fit.

Consolidating work with one technician generally produces better outcomes than distributing it, because the technician learns your preparations, your photography, and your preferences. That learning is real and it takes cases to accumulate.

Visiting the laboratory, where practical, changes the relationship considerably. Watching someone build a restoration makes it much clearer why the information you send matters.

Key Takeaways

  • The technician works entirely from what is sent; outcome quality is capped by information quality.
  • Standardised photography communicates more than written description and improves as it becomes consistent.
  • Take shade before isolation, since dehydrated teeth lighten and the record becomes inaccurate.
  • Photograph shade tabs in frame, and record the preparation shade for thin restorations.
  • A prescription should convey intent, including what the patient wants avoided.
  • Inadequate preparation space forces the technician to choose between over-contouring and a flat result.
  • An approved provisional is a specification; changes are far cheaper in resin than in ceramic.

Frequently Asked Questions

When should shade be taken?

At the beginning of the appointment, before isolation and prolonged retraction, since teeth lighten as they dehydrate. Consistent lighting and photographing the tab alongside the tooth both improve accuracy considerably, and multiple tabs bracketing the estimate give the technician more to work with than a single one.

Does the preparation shade really matter?

For thin restorations, yes. Ceramic at that thickness is not fully opaque, so the substrate influences the final appearance. A discoloured or endodontically treated tooth beneath a thin restoration will show through unless the technician knows and can plan around it. Recording and photographing the prepared shade prevents a predictable disappointment.

How much should be included in a prescription?

Enough that a technician who has never spoken with you could produce what you intend. That generally means the patient’s request in their own words, what was agreed, what to preserve, how much characterisation is wanted, and what to avoid. On complex cases a conversation supplements rather than replaces the written brief.

Is a digital workflow better than conventional?

Both produce excellent results in capable hands, and the determining factors are the quality of the capture and the clarity of the margins rather than the technology. A poorly captured scan and a poorly taken impression cause the same problem. Whichever is used, the technician needs to be able to read where the preparation ends.

What if the patient does not like the result at try-in?

That is what try-in is for, and it is far better than the alternative. Establish specifically what they dislike, since the objection is frequently narrower than the initial reaction suggests. Photographs and the approved provisional provide a reference for what was agreed, which makes the conversation constructive rather than a disagreement about recollection.

Should I use one laboratory or several?

Consolidating generally produces better results, because a technician learns your preparations, photography, and preferences over cases and that learning is genuine. Distributing work resets it each time. The exception is where a particular case calls for a specialised capability that a regular technician does not offer.

Conclusion

The laboratory builds what the information supports. Photography that is consistent, shade taken before the teeth dehydrate, a prescription that conveys intent, preparations with adequate space, and a provisional the patient has actually approved will produce better outcomes than any change of ceramic or supplier. It is also the part of the workflow most clinicians have never been taught, which makes it one of the more available improvements in esthetic practice.
